The Issue – Physician – Know your schedule!

For 23 years, my partner and I ran into several problems in our thriving OB-GYN practice. We had to establish a routine in order to try to eliminate some of these problem areas.

Surgery Scheduling

Because of the nature of surgery scheduling, each night we would have to call the page operator at both hospitals where we practiced and ask to check our updated surgery schedules. Next, we would have to call both obstetrical units and ask if there were any inductions scheduled for the next day. The problem with our schedules was that surgeries and inductions were often added after we left the office. By calling at night, we would know exactly what we had to do the following day to avoid the embarrassing phone call from the operating room wondering when we were going to appear for our surgery. This was a time consuming and confusing situation.

Office Scheduling

As every physician knows, office scheduling is also a problem. Our practice had two separate offices with separate scheduling software. Every time our staff scheduled a surgery or office appointment, one office had to call the other office and tell them the date and time of the appointment so that we would not be double booked – and vice-versa! The cost of setting up the lines to make a network in separate locations is prohibitive and involves large monthly charges for these connections. Many of my colleagues had “satellite” offices where they would see patients once or twice a week. One plastic surgeon saw patients in five satellite offices. This forced him to hand carry all the charts with him. Scheduling future appointments for these patients was a logistical nightmare. Either they had to call their primary office for every patient to schedule the next appointment or they told the patients that they would call them back and schedule appointments at a later date when they were back in the office.

“No Shows”

When patients do not show for their appointment, an opportunity for income is lost forever. With patients waiting several weeks for appointments, it is understandable that some will simply forget. Appointment reminders are a simple way to increase office income. But how do you do this? We tried having our staff call patients before their appointments. This was not effective because patients were often not home when the office was open. The extra time spent in this task for our staff did not prove cost-effective.
